Completion of 7.6km Water Main Upgrade in County Waterford
A 7.6km drinking water main upgrade in County Waterford has been completed to enhance supply and quality. This project addresses inadequate infrastructure supporting developing areas and aims to prevent future water-related issues.

Uisce Eireann has finished constructing a 7.6km water main connecting Dunhill to the Ballyvadden Reservoir in County Waterford. This project addresses the insufficient drinking water network previously serving Ballylaneen, Bunmahon, Kill, and Annestown, which faced multiple supply and quality issues.
A new booster pump has also been installed in Dunhill to help meet current and future demand. The initiative aligns with Uisce Eireann's broader national strategy for water supply improvements in regional areas, which is critical for preventing boil water and do not consume notices previously issued.
